How to Clean Your Dishwasher’s Motor for Better Performance

Linkek Joe

You might have problems with your dishwasher not cleaning dishes well or hearing water running but the appliance won’t start. These issues can happen with any brand or type of gadget. In this article, we will show you how to clean the dishwasher’s motor. Make sure your device can take in and drain water before doing this.

Remove The Dishwasher

1. Detach the device. Unscrew the screws on the sides or top of the gadget.

2. Remove the unit. Use a wrench to adjust the front or back legs. If the water supply hose is too short, you will need to disconnect it.

How to Clean the Motor

1. Place a blanket under the dishwasher and lay it on its side to create space for working underneath. You may need to remove the bottom panel to access the parts.

2. Locate the pump. It’s usually secured with a thread that can be twisted off.

3. Inspect the pump casing. Find the bracket rod and press it to remove the motor. Follow the arrow on the pump to determine the direction of movement.

After removing the motor, disconnect it from the wiring. Check for any dirt or debris and clean it thoroughly. If there’s a significant amount of dirt, clean it off and reinstall the motor to test it. If the issue persists, open the motor by unscrewing it. Use paper towels and water to clean it inside and out.

Cleaning the Dishwasher Circulation and Drain Pump Motors

It can help your dishwasher clean dishes better. The drain pump motor may get clogged, which stops water from draining. If cleaning does not fix the problem, you should turn to professionals.

When cleaning the motor, follow these steps:

1. Take out debris: Check the motor for any visible debris and take it out.

2. Clean with water and towels: Use paper towels and water to clean the motor inside and out.

3. Put the motor back: Once cleaned, put the motor back into its original position.

Regular cleaning of the circulation and drain pump motors can help keep your dishwasher working well. However, if you have more problems or are unsure about any steps, it is best to get professional help.
